Expected Pattern

Clean switching pattern with sharp drop to near 0V during dwell, followed by inductive spike to 200-350V at plug firing

Known-Good Waveform

Primary waveform shows battery voltage flat-line during coil-off period, then sharp drop to near 0V as coil saturates (dwell time approximately 3-4ms at idle). At end of dwell, voltage spikes to 200-350V as magnetic field collapses, then oscillates and settles back to battery voltage. Dwell time increases with RPM.

Common Failure Patterns

Reduced or absent voltage spike, extended dwell time, excessive oscillation after spark event
Cause: Weak coil windings, internal coil breakdown, or failing igniter transistor in ECM
Related DTCs: P0351, P0352, P0353, P0354, P0355, P0356
Erratic dwell time, inconsistent trigger signal
Cause: Poor connector contact at coil, corroded pins, or ECM driver circuit failure
Related DTCs: P0351, P030X

Diagnostic Tips

2GR-FKS engine uses smart coil control with ECM-integrated drivers. Always check connector moisture at valve cover coils as this is a common failure point. Compare dwell times across all six cylinders for consistency.
